What is Investment Property?

Investment property refers to real estate that is invested in for generating income. This can be through renting the property or benefiting from appreciation over time.

The Process of Investing in Property

The typical process includes several important stages:

  • Analyzing the market to identify growing locations.
  • Obtaining financing, which can involve a mortgage with an interest rate that can be as low as 3% to 6% depending on your credit.
  • Executing due diligence, which includes background checks on the property.
  • Closing the purchase, which usually takes around 30 to 60 days.

How Much Does Investment Property Cost in Columbia?

Investment Property Costs

Costs can vary widely based on market conditions. Generally, expect to pay between $100,000 and $500,000 for the acquisition of a property. Additional costs include:

  • Closing costs, which can be around 2% and 5% of the purchase price.
  • Property management fees, typically 5% to 10% of monthly rent.
  • Renovation costs that can vary from $1,000 to $50,000 depending on the extent of updates needed.

Remember that while some investments are worth the cost, others may not yield the desired returns.

How to Choose the Right Provider

  • Confirm that the provider has a valid real estate license.
  • Ensure they have sufficient insurance, including errors and omissions coverage.
  • Inquire about their experience with properties similar to yours.
  • Request case studies to gauge their success with past clients.
  • Cover their fee structure to avoid hidden costs.

Warning Signs & Red Flags

  • If a provider refuses provide references, it's a red flag.
  • Beware of guarantees for returns; returns can vary greatly.
  • If their fees seem excessively low, be cautious.
  • Providers who pressure you to make quick decisions may not have your best interests at heart.
